Phish 12/31/95
Madison Square Garden, New York, NY
Set I
Punch You In The Eye, The Sloth, Reba, The Squirming Coil, Maze, Colonel Forbin's Ascent > Fly Famous Mockingbird > Shine* > Fly Famous Mockingbird, Sparkle, Chalk Dust Torture
Set II
Drowned, The Lizards, Axilla (Part II), Runaway Jim, Strange Design, Hello My Baby**, Mike's Song***
Set III
Gamehendge Time Phactory > Auld Lang Syne# > Weekapaug Groove## > Sea And Sand, You Enjoy Myself, Sanity, Frankenstein

E: Johnny B. Goode
Comment
* - Included narration about "The Recipe for Time"; Tom Marshall sings lyrics to this cover by Collective Soul; First time played

** - A capella

*** - Ended with only Trey left on stage creating a series of delay loops to end the set

# - Phish dressed as scientists playing with synthesizers while lights flashed and Va de Graff generators zapped; Fishman (dressed as Father Time) is raised up in a bed and reborn as Baby New Year

## - With Auld Lang Syne tease
